EXPERIENCED  REAL ESTATE ACCOUNTANT FRENCH/ENGLISH  SPEAKING (M/F)

THE JOB:
DO Recruitment Advisors is delighted to represent one of its clients, an international leading Real Estate entity company  in Europe,   in their search for An Experienced Real Estate  Accountant (M/F) French/English  speaking.
The successful candidate will be responsible for the day to day accounting operations and compliance of a large portfolio of real estate entities and investments (property and holding companies) in Europe.
This specific position operates in the team dedicated to the accounting management of a portfolio Real Estate assets and entities.
Given the high volume and dynamism in the portfolio,  the role requires the successful candidate to be proactive, highly organized and stress resistant.
As part of the  role, not only the Experienced Real Estate  Accountant   will have to interact with the accounting team mates but also with other departments (legal and compliance, accounts payable, treasury, reporting, controllership,  FP&A …) thus requiring good coordination skills.
Accounting 
– Liaise with property managers and ensure accuracy of all bookings including reconciliation of rental income to rent rolls, review of all service charge costs and income and accurate allocation of non-recoverable property costs.
– Take care of day to day accounting for PropCos and HoldCos including, bank reconciliations, invoice review, monthly accruals, depreciation, etc.
– Take care of maintaining supporting schedules: accruals for both property and entity level, depreciation and amortization schedules, etc.
– Assist in preparation of periodic VAT returns.
– Ensure accurate recording of all local, IFRS and Group GAAP adjustments.
– Respect periodic closing process timelines.
– Assist with consolidations and sub-consolidations.
– Coordinate and help in the preparation ofstand-alone financial statements.
– Provide intercompany reconciliations and regular intercompany settlements where applicable.Contribute to the interim and final group audit process and statutory when required, ensuring completion on a timely basis.
Cash management:
– Liaise with Treasury team to help ensuring adequate and consistent funding within the different structures
Asset management, acquisitions & Sales support:   
– Support asset management team with ad hoc financial information / analysis as required.
– Support in monitoring operating budgets, liquidity and cash management for investments.
Process imrovement:   
– Assist with continuous improvement initiatives for all financial reporting processes and suggest (or even participate in) Yardi enhancements.
